Exploration booms in BC's Quesnel Trough

Vancouver -- Perception matters in mining, and for much of the 1990s, British Columbia was not perceived as a favourable exploration destination. Onerous government policies, land-use battles, and low metal prices all took their toll, and by 2001, exploration spending...
